Spectacular Nature Day!

April 30th 10 am-2 pm at the Intervale Center

ALL ARE WELCOME. Whether you're a regular visitor of the Greater Burlington natural areas or have always wanted to explore, there are plenty of engaging opportunities to participate in!

 

  • City Nature Challenge: a self-guided bioblitz challenge using the iNaturalist app. Observe the species active in our area and see what you can discover! Naturalists will be available for guidance or see our iNaturalist resources

  • Planting events: help plant young fiddlehead (ostrich) ferns in the forest! 

  • Sustainable foraging: learn harvesting practices for foraging plants and enjoy eating them! Japanese Knotweed ice cream, anyone?🍦

  • Tabling: learn about nature and climate action initiatives from our tabling partners such as Burlington Wildways, Grow Wild, and others!

  • Birding, special guests and more!
